§ 50.25 RIGHT OF ENTRY.
   The city has the right to enter in and upon private property, including buildings and dwelling houses, in or upon which is installed a municipal utility or connection therewith, at all times reasonable under the circumstances, for the purpose of reading utility meters, for the purpose of inspection and repairs to meters or a utility system or any part thereof, and for the purpose of connecting and disconnecting service.
(Prior Code, § 3.05)
